When storm clouds produce lightning and thunder, energy changes to energy and energy.
balandron [24]
When storm clouds produce lightening and thunder, then, potential energy changes into kinectic energy.

The clouds become negatively charged,and the ground is positively charged during a storm. So there creates a potential difference between the charged clouds and the ground. And when this becomes huge so much that it over comes the electrical insulation cover of air, the electrons jump to the ground.i.e. the potential energy changes into kinetic energy.

The equation T^2=A^3 shows the relationship between a planet’s orbital period, T, and the planet’s mean distance from the sun, A
kobusy [5.1K]

Answer:

D. 2^(3/2)

Explanation:

Given that

T² = A³

Let the mean distance between the sun and planet Y be x

Therefore,

T(Y)² = x³

T(Y) = x^(3/2)

Let the mean distance between the sun and planet X be x/2

Therefore,

T(Y)² = (x/2)³

T(Y) = (x/2)^(3/2)

The factor of increase from planet X to planet Y is:

T(Y) / T(X) = x^(3/2) / (x/2)^(3/2)

T(Y) / T(X) = (2)^(3/2)
